Onboarding: the donation-receipt mailer (service name Gratia) runs nightly at 01:30 and sends receipts for the prior day's gifts. If it fails, it retries twice, then alerts on-call. Safe to rerun manually; it's idempotent by gift ID. Never edit templates in production — donors get legally sensitive tax text. For template or tax-language questions, reach the stewardship team below.

escalation mailbox, badug-tawip: ulaath@nelvroforge.example

# Findwell Relevance Tuning — Environments

Quick notes for the security review. Relevance weights live per environment: sandbox lets analysts tweak boosts freely, staging mirrors prod weekly, prod changes need sign-off from the search guild. Nothing here touches user data directly — it's all scoring knobs. The tuning service reads its environment settings from the block below.

deployment values, kafof-yagap:
[druwyn]
host = druwyn.nelvrolabs.internal
user = druwyn_svc
database = druwyn_prod

RESTRICTED — Managers Only

Support Outsourcing Plan — Project Keelmark

This page documents the proposal to transition tier-one customer support for the Orvane platform to Halloway Partner Services over three phases. Staffing impact, service-level commitments, and transition costs are detailed in the linked appendices. The board should note that retention packages for affected staff remain under negotiation. The broader rationale is set out in the note below.

internal memo for faweg-tafog: Only 7 of the 100 pilot accounts renewed Quenael, so a churn review is set for April 15.